在VS2017中使用GitHub的详细指南

在现代软件开发中,GitHub 作为一个强大的版本控制和协作平台,已成为开发者的重要工具。而 Visual Studio 2017 (VS2017) 的集成开发环境使得与 GitHub 的协作变得更加便捷。本文将详细介绍如何在VS2017中配置和使用GitHub,帮助开发者更高效地进行版本控制和团队协作。

1. 安装与配置VS2017的GitHub支持

在开始之前,确保你的VS2017版本已经更新到最新,并且安装了相关的Git支持。

1.1 安装Git

  • 步骤1: 前往 Git官网 下载并安装最新版本的Git。
  • 步骤2: 在安装过程中,选择与VS2017的集成选项。

1.2 配置VS2017

  • 打开VS2017,选择菜单栏中的 工具 > 选项
  • 在左侧选择 源代码管理,然后选择 Git
  • 输入你的GitHub账户信息,包括用户名和电子邮件。

2. 在VS2017中连接到GitHub

连接到GitHub后,用户可以直接在VS2017中进行代码提交、推送和拉取等操作。

2.1 连接到GitHub账户

  • 在VS2017的右下角,点击 登录 按钮。
  • 输入你的GitHub账户信息进行授权。

2.2 克隆GitHub项目

  • 打开 团队资源管理器,选择 连接
  • 点击 克隆,然后输入GitHub项目的URL。
  • 选择本地文件夹进行存储。

3. 在VS2017中创建和管理GitHub项目

创建新项目或在已有项目中进行管理。

3.1 创建新项目

  • 选择 文件 > 新建 > 项目
  • 在弹出的窗口中选择你的项目模板,然后命名。
  • 创建后,在 解决方案资源管理器 中右键点击解决方案,选择 Git > 添加解决方案到源代码管理

3.2 提交更改

  • 团队资源管理器 中选择 更改
  • 输入提交信息,然后点击 提交
  • 提交后可选择 推送 将更改同步到GitHub。

4. 使用GitHub的最佳实践

为了充分利用GitHub的优势,开发者应遵循一些最佳实践。

4.1 编写清晰的提交信息

  • 提交信息应简明扼要,说明更改内容。
  • 使用统一的格式,以便团队成员理解历史记录。

4.2 定期推送代码

  • 定期将本地更改推送到GitHub,以避免丢失进度。
  • 推送后,可以让团队成员及时看到最新进展。

4.3 使用分支管理功能

  • 在进行大幅修改前,建议新建分支,以避免影响主分支。
  • 在完成工作后,可以通过合并请求将分支合并回主分支。

5. FAQ(常见问题解答)

5.1 如何在VS2017中查看Git日志?

  • 团队资源管理器 中,选择 历史 标签即可查看提交历史和相关信息。

5.2 如何解决Git合并冲突?

  • 当合并冲突发生时,VS2017会自动提示。通过编辑相关文件并解决冲突后,重新提交即可。

5.3 是否可以直接在VS2017中进行代码审查?

  • 是的,通过创建拉取请求,你可以直接在VS2017中对代码进行审查和讨论。

5.4 如何在VS2017中管理多个GitHub账户?

  • 目前VS2017不支持同时管理多个账户,需通过 工具 > 选项 > 源代码管理 来切换账户。

结论

通过以上步骤,开发者可以轻松地在 Visual Studio 2017 中与 GitHub 集成,优化版本控制和协作流程。掌握这些基本操作后,你将能更高效地进行软件开发工作。

正文完